They vaulted past the Clemson Tigers to win the ACC Atlantic Division championship, due to Clemson\u2019s pair of losses to Pittsburgh and North Carolina State. Wake Forest did lose to Clemson, but it didn\u2019t lose to anyone else, so it beat the Tigers by one game in the standings. The Deacs reached the ACC Championship Game before losing to Pittsburgh. It was a better year than anyone in Winston-Salem, North Carolina, had a right to expect. Now coach Dave Clawson gets quarterback Sam Hartman back for one more run at a conference championship. The continuity Wake has at the quarterback spot gives the Deacs a legitimate chance at defending their division title and getting another appearance in the conference championship game.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Key Personnel Lost<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The Demon Deacons lost offensive guard Zach Tom, who was taken in the fourth round of the NFL draft, plus cornerback Ja\u2019Sir Taylor. Those were two very dependable players for the 2021 team, and the 2022 roster will need to adequately replace them.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Important Incoming Freshmen<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Wake Forest has signed two four-star prospects, receiver Wesley Grimes and running back Demond Claiborne, who will try to provide depth on the offensive side of the ball and make sure the program maintains the high standard it has set on offense in recent years.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>On defense, the Demon Deacons grabbed a few three-star prospects, including defensive lineman Eli Hall, linebacker Derrell Johnson, cornerback Zamari Stevenson, defensive lineman Jalen Swindell, cornerback Andre Hodge, and linebacker Tommy Bebie. Wake Forest is not going to get five-star athletes very often, so accumulating a considerable number of three-star players it can then develop into dependable players is the recruiting philosophy which works for this particular program, given its level of size and its amount of overall resources.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>It will also be interesting to see how incoming transfer defensive lineman Kobie Turner elevates the front four.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Key Position Battles<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Wake Forest is going to be very good on offense once again with Hartman returning at quarterback, in charge of a high-powered passing attack guided by elite offensive coordinator Warren Ruggiero. The big need for Wake Forest is the defensive line, which got shoved around at times last season. Wake was bullied by Clemson\u2019s offensive line. The Tigers did not have a very good passing game last year, but because their offensive line dominated Wake Forest\u2019s front four, Clemson was still able to do everything it wanted on offense, something which certainly caught the eye of the Wake Forest coaching staff.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Identifying the best defensive linemen, particularly on the interior to defend against the run, will be the main thing to watch when the Wake Forest staff sorts out its roster and depth chart before Week 1.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Biggest Offseason Goal(s)<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Defensive line toughness is the name of the game. Wake Forest had so many strengths in 2021, but the weak defensive line was vulnerable to Clemson\u2019s power and Pittsburgh\u2019s passing attack in late-season battles. Wake\u2019s defense doesn\u2019t need to be spectacular, but it does need to be somewhat more resilient if the Deacs are going to defend their division title and have a 2022 season which is similarly successful compared to 2021.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>The Wake Forest Demon Deacons had a very special season in 2021.
